A large tank is fi lled with methane gas at a concentration of 0.650 kg/m3 . The valve of a 1.50-m pipe connecting the tank to the atmosphere is inadvertently left open for twelve hours. During this time, 9.00 3 1024 kg of methane diff uses out of the tank, leaving the concentration of methane in the tank essentially unchanged. The diff usion constant for methane in air is 2.10 3 1025 m2 /s. What is the cross-sectional area of the pipe? Assume that the concentration of methane in the atmosphere is zero.
